
GPRC5D-Directed Therapies Poised for Growth Amidst Unmet Needs in Multiple Myeloma Treatment
A recent report from DelveInsight, published by PR Newswire, forecasts significant momentum for the GPRC5D-directed therapies market between 2025 and 2034. This anticipated growth is primarily driven by the persistent unmet need for more effective and targeted treatment options for patients suffering from multiple myeloma.
Multiple myeloma, a cancer of plasma cells, remains a challenging disease to manage, with a considerable portion of patients experiencing relapses or developing resistance to existing therapies. This ongoing struggle highlights the critical importance of developing novel therapeutic approaches that can offer better outcomes and improve the quality of life for those affected.
The report by DelveInsight points to G protein-coupled receptor class C group 5 member D (GPRC5D) as a promising target for new therapies. GPRC5D is a cell surface protein that has shown significant expression on multiple myeloma cells, making it an attractive candidate for targeted drug development. Therapies designed to target GPRC5D aim to selectively destroy cancer cells while minimizing damage to healthy tissues, a crucial aspect of effective cancer treatment.
The increasing focus on precision medicine and the development of antibody-drug conjugates (ADCs) and other targeted therapies are expected to fuel the market expansion. These advanced therapeutic modalities offer the potential for enhanced efficacy and potentially reduced side effects compared to conventional chemotherapy.
